Can I install a S5 13b T into a 88' shell?

Can I install a S5 13B t (engine,ecu,tranny,wiring harness)into a 1988 FC?

I agree, but with money of course anything is possible. You really only have two options. One is to get the complete wiring with all sensors from a S5 or go standalone.

Yes it can be done, there are plenty of threads on how to rewire S5 into S4 but it is ALOT of work. Now would be the time to go standalone if you ever have plans for it.

You can also run S4 Accesories on the S5 block and avoid rewiring it.
